Not too long after rumors started floating around that Tommy Rees, the current offensive coordinator at Notre Dame, had emerged as the top candidate for Alabama's vacant offensive coordinator position, a public flight tracking website showed the aircraft N1UA en route to South Bend.

N1UA is owned by the Crimson Tide Foundation and is regularly used by Nick Saban for recruiting trips.

As of the publishing of this article, the plane is back in the air on its way to Tuscaloosa. Rees is expected to interview today, per ESPN's Chris Low.

According to Pete Sampson, no decision has been made on Rees' end regarding the job.

If the interview goes well, it is more than possible an announcement of his hire could come as soon as today.
